Zusammenfassung

In Deutschland treten 262.000 Schlaganfälle pro Jahr auf. Das Alter ist einer der wichtigsten nicht modifizierbaren Risikofaktoren, so dass allein durch die demografische Entwicklung mit einer weiteren Zunahme zu rechnen ist. Lebensstil-Risikofaktoren wie Nikotinkonsum, Übergewicht und körperliche Inaktivität bieten neben klassischen Faktoren wie arterielle Hypertonie und Diabetes mellitus optimale Ansatzpunkte für die Primärprävention. Durch das Nichtraucherschutzgesetz konnte in Deutschland eine Abnahme des Nikotinkonsums und bereits eine Reduktion kardiovaskulärer Ereignisse beobachtet werden. Einer Zunahme des Körpergewichtes in der Gesamtbevölkerung könnte mit Hilfe einer verbesserten Gesundheitserziehung (körperliche Aktivität, Ernährung) und Lebensmittelkennzeichnung begegnet werden. In der medikamentösen Primärprophylaxe hat der Einsatz von ASS aufgrund von Blutungsnebenwirkungen an Stellenwert verloren, während der Einsatz von Statinen patientenindividuell diskutiert wird.
